‘I know I messed up’: Love Is Blind’s Shake says he’s ‘a good person’ and wants to be better

He says the show made him look worse than he was


The wedding of Shake and Deepti in season two of Love Is Blind was a rollercoaster of emotion and feelings. We’ve never been more proud of Deepti, choosing herself and ditching Shake, who had been constantly questioning how he felt about her and making comments about not finding her physically attractive. Then there was Shake’s reaction to the rejection, trying to play it off like he would have said no and wasn’t fussed – it was all very schoolboy who just got turned down by his crush.

The drama didn’t stop there. Everyone was shocked by Shake’s pretty immature reaction and then Deepti’s brother posted a lengthy statement calling Shake a “loser” and a “clown” who they “welcomed into our home and you saw it as an opportunity for clout”. Now, Shake has posted a video on Instagram explaining he knows he messed up, and has been getting lots of hate since the show aired.

In the video, he admitted to making mistakes during his time with Deepti, but tried to say the show made it look a lot worse than it actually was.  “Hello again. So I’ve been getting all kinds of messages, DMs, comments, emails – saying all kinds of stuff,” he began. “And I want you guys to know, I know I made some mistakes. I for sure did, and the way it kind of played out on TV was way worse than it even was. But, I know that I messed up in a lot of ways.”

He goes on to say he believes his friends would back him up that he’s a good person, and then asks for suggestions on how to be a better person. “I’m not perfect, I think I’m a good person,” he said. “I think if, you know, you asked someone who knew me they’d say ‘Shake’s a good guy, maybe not the greatest at relationships’. Yeah, maybe there’s a reason I’ve been single. So, let’s try and keep it constructive. I wanna be better. If you have a suggestion for how to make me better, let me know. Maybe keep all the hate to yourself for now – I don’t know, I’m a human.”

And guess who’s in the comments backing Shake up? Damian from season one. “💯💯💯 respect for this!” he commented. Take from that what you will. Another comment adds: “Maybe just don’t humiliate someone you ‘love’ on national TV. Doesn’t seem very hard to me.” Whilst another just asks him: “How was Nobu”.
